Visit us at booth # G2030 Proud member Independant Dealer Association
Case Heavy Equipment Parts

Google Vision Ocr Example Java

This code sample is included in the trial download. You can recognize objects, landmarks, faces, detect inappropriate content, perform image sentiment analysis and extract text. Subscribe Now Filed Under: Deep Learning , how-to , OCR , OpenCV 3 , Text Recognition , Tools , Tutorial Tagged With: deep learning , ocr , OpenCV 3 , tesseract , tutorial. This example uses the Cloud Vision API to detect text within images, stores this text in an index, and then lets you query this index. The Computer Vision API provides state-of-the-art algorithms to process images and return information. 2018 : Dynamsoft Document Capture Cloud Java Sample Code: The Dynamsoft Document Capture Cloud Java Sample Code demonstrates how to convert image to text by using DDC Ocr. Developers can access code to import libraries, API to recognize an image, and run application. To quickly switch between 3 languages, use the OCR language quick access keys: Windows Key + 1, Windows Key + 2, and Windows Key + 3. The examples are extracted from open source Java projects. One huge advantage to using OCR in Google Drive is that you can easily share the new document with whomever you need to. Computer vision and machine learning news, C++ source code for Opencv in Visual Studio and linux. The Text API detects text in Latin based languages (French, German, English, etc. Matrix Matching compares what the OCR scanner recognizes as a character with a library of character matrices or templates. Vision API - Azure Cognitive Services.


More… I've made two short videos about this project: one that describes how this was built and the other one that demonstrates how it works. Introduction In our previous article we learned how to Analyze an Image Using Computer Vision API With ASP. Google Vision API - Examples and Python utilities. In this tutorial, you will learn how to apply OpenCV OCR (Optical Character Recognition). This page contains information about getting started with the Cloud Vision API using the Google API Client Library for. Three birds with one stone B4A Tutorial MJPEG / CCTV Server B4A Question (of OCR only. By setting variables a perfect balance between speed and accuracy can be found though working with real world examples. Most codelabs will step you through the process of building a small application, or adding a new feature to an existing application. For the OCR task at hand, it’s very common to code each pattern as a vector of size 26 (because we have 26 different letters), placing into the vector “0.


My idea is to upload a image/jpeg file, get ist FILE_ID as response and query back (or do it async in one step) with the file id to check the file is converted to OCR of ascii text/plain. With these few samples it is hard to make a claim, but for every request it took Watson more time than Google. System requirements:. Optical character recognition (OCR) software provides the ability to convert scanned documents and images into editable and searchable documents in a variety of output formats. OCR SOAP API Developer's Guide. Vision API - Azure Cognitive Services. However, it is not entirely straightforward to use the library when behind a proxy, especially one that requires authentication, and when connecting over HTTPS. Explore a JavaScript application that uses the Computer Vision REST API to perform optical character recognition (OCR), create smart-cropped thumbnails, plus detect, categorize, tag, and describe visual features, including faces, in an image. GitHub Gist: instantly share code, notes, and snippets. Example of using OCR and Image Automation Suggest Edits Since OCR and Image automation usually go hand in hand due to the difficulty of automating in virtual environments, we created an automation that retrieves an employee's email and the invoice number from a scanned invoice.


UnsatisfiedLinkError: Unable to load library 'libtesseract302' " it seems that this problem is caused by the usage of 32 bits dll in a 64bits jvm. The advantage is that the DMS appliance's CPU is not consumed by the OCR processing and that the OCR process takes advantage of the high accuracy and potential speed of the Google Cloud Vision technology. Between 1995 and 2006 it had little work done on it, but since then it has been improved extensively by Google. The resulting tool, Cloudy Vision, presents image labeling results from Microsoft, Google, IBM, Clarifai, and Cloud Sight, but is easy to extend to support more vendors (please send me a pull request). I decided to try OCR because I received a WhatsApp message with a photo of the monthly menu at school, and … why not can I study what the children are eating? Installing the tools. A few weeks ago I showed you how to perform text detection using OpenCV's EAST deep learning model. In general, though, OCR typically refers to printed text only, unless otherwise specified. If you want to use Hindi, the English traineddata file must also exist in the same folder as the Hindi traineddata file. Documentation and Java Code. So verwendet Google Cookies. gradle file, make sure to include Google's Maven repository in both your buildscript and allprojects sections. At Docparser we learned how to improve OCR accuracy the hard way and spent weeks on fine-tuning our OCR engine. Google Vision OCR Android App. Microsoft Cognitive Services However, we will only explore the Computer Vision API and its OCR method. When backed by their Machine Vision infrastructure, this API enables developer to give their applications vision capability. QR Code scanner or Barcode scanner for android features are present in many apps to read some useful data. There are two types of PDF documents – those created by sending Office files, images, etc. I have integrated Google Cloud Vision API in my java application for text recognition from complex formatted documents. These sample apps show how you can easily use the Cloud Vision label detection, landmark detection, and text recognition APIs from your mobile apps with ML Kit for Firebase. In this tutorial, I am going to help you get started with it. Amazon Rekognition: Object Detection The Object Detection functionality of Google Cloud Vision and Amazon Rekognition is almost identical, both syntactically and semantically.


Safe Search Detection to detect inappropriate content within your image. Mobile platform examples Vision API and more with ML Kit for Firebase. Reading Text from Images Using Java. This tutorial shows the features of the Microsoft Cognitive Services Computer Vision REST API by using Java. 1 seconds for IBM. Teaseract is ok printed material that's neatly organized, but other than that it seems the only other programmatic ocr is google cloud vision. Java - Basic Program. Try instantly, no registration required. DMS will issue commands so that documents to be OCR'ed are uploaded to Google Cloud, OCR is performed there, and the result is returned. gradle file, make sure to include Google's Maven repository in both your buildscript and allprojects sections. In this post I would like to show how to easily run image recognition in the cloud with a little help of powerful deep learning models. Google Vision API は OCR が API 経由で使えるサービスです 1000 ユニットまでは無料で使えます ユニットは画像に含まれる解析対象の情報の単位です (例えば 1 枚の画像から 1 つのテキストと 1 つの顔認識をする場合は 2 ユニット). TAGGUN also takes advantage of Google Vision API and Microsoft Cognitive Service API to perform the image-to-text OCR. To achieve this, it created a staff Experience-a-thon , where employees could test and provide feedback on Adobe products, not from their viewpoint as. If you haven't already, add Firebase to your Android project. Skip navigation Sign in. So far, the best OCR to choose on production code can be found with Google Vision API (which scans and results the image attributes as REST JSON). More… I've made two short videos about this project: one that describes how this was built and the other one that demonstrates how it works. OpenRTK – ExperVision OCR SDK “Overall, ExperVision Recognition Toolkit (the OCR engine of ExperVision) performed the best in this year’s test (among OmniPage, …and other OCR software). You will need to install and configure the Google Cloud SDK before this co. Getting Started Installation. Call the scan() method of the TJ4LBarcode1DReader barcodes:=reader.


Tesseract 4. What Is Google's Vision Statement? Google's official mission or vision statement is to organize all of the data in the world and make it accessible for everyone in a useful way. Explore a JavaScript application that uses the Computer Vision REST API to perform optical character recognition (OCR), create smart-cropped thumbnails, plus detect, categorize, tag, and describe visual features, including faces, in an image. B4A Library OCR, FaceRecognition, BarcodeScanner using Google Vision. If you haven't already, add Firebase to your Android project. …So we're going to go to the console…and run the tutorial on this. Analyze images and extract the data you need with the Computer Vision API from Microsoft Azure. For this week's write-up we will create a simple Android app that uses Google Mobile Vision API's for Optical character recognition(OCR). However, it is not entirely straightforward to use the library when behind a proxy, especially one that requires authentication, and when connecting over HTTPS. The sample app then uses Vision to apply the Core ML model to the chosen image, and shows the resulting classification labels along with numbers indicating the confidence. OpenCV is a cross-platform library using which we can develop real-time computer vision applications. Just a quickie test in Python 3 (using Requests) to see if Google Cloud Vision can be used to effectively OCR a scanned data table and preserve its structure, in the way that products such as ABBYY FineReader can OCR an image and provide Excel-ready output. In this example to make a Google Cloud Vision API request on Android, we will be using Google API Client library for java.


This sample requires Java 8. For example, the model used in this project accepts an image as the input and returns a descriptive string as the output. The Computer Vision API provides state-of-the-art algorithms to process images and return information. This technique is called Optical Character Recognition (OCR) and I want to show you how this can be used to help enhance the content in your Azure Search index. Projects Community Docs. OCR Test Images The images below are intended to be a severe test of optical character recognition (OCR) software. The Vision API can detect and transcribe text from PDF and TIFF files stored in Google Cloud Storage. In this tutorial, we will learn how to do Optical Character Recognition with a Camera in Android using Vision API. As a market leader, ABBYY offers the highest number of OCR languages, which can be individually combined. The advantage is that the DMS appliance's CPU is not consumed by the OCR processing and that the OCR process takes advantage of the high accuracy and potential speed of the Google Cloud Vision technology. UnsatisfiedLinkError: Unable to load library 'libtesseract302' " it seems that this problem is caused by the usage of 32 bits dll in a 64bits jvm. The Cloud Vision API. 5” for positions corresponding to the pattern’s type number and “-0. Computer Vision API - v2. At time of writing, the Google Cloud Vision API is in beta, which means that it’s free to try. The OCR function can be called from Apps Script as well with the Drive REST API v2. 5 seconds for Google and 3. Vision API - Azure Cognitive Services. Get to grips with the basics of Computer Vision and image processing This is a step-by-step guide to developing several real-world Computer Vision projects using OpenCV 3 This book takes a special focus on working with Tesseract OCR, a free, open-source library to recognize text in images. This example uses the Cloud Vision API to detect text within images, stores this text in an index, and then lets you query this index. For example, Google’s most popular product is its search engine service. This page provides Java source code for MainActivity. The resulting tool, Cloudy Vision, presents image labeling results from Microsoft, Google, IBM, Clarifai, and Cloud Sight, but is easy to extend to support more vendors (please send me a pull request). 参考:AndroidでCloudVisionを使った際のGoogle Developer Consoleの登録の流れ.


Install Visual Studio Code for Java Before you begin. B4A Library OCR, FaceRecognition, BarcodeScanner using Google Vision. Download the project as a. js was used for OCR (Optical Character Recognition). It was a fun experience. トップ > OCR > 今更だけどGoogle Cloud Vision APIでOCR その1 この広告は、90日以上更新していないブログに表示しています。 2016 - 09 - 01. Im very new this btw. Right-click any of the images, and then do one of the following: Click Copy Text from this Page of the Printout to copy text from only the currently selected image (page). Search the world's information, including webpages, images, videos and more. In this article, we are going to learn how to use Google Vision API with ASP. I couldn't find anything similar to that in R for the Microsoft Cognitive Services API so I thought I would give it a shot. To do so, go to File > Share, and you can add collaborators by sharing a link or sending an invitation via email. Google Cloud의 Vision API 사용해보기. It's a hundred times better, but unfortunately I need to OCR documents I can't contractual show the mighty G.


GoogleCloudOCR. Example of using OCR and Image Automation Suggest Edits Since OCR and Image automation usually go hand in hand due to the difficulty of automating in virtual environments, we created an automation that retrieves an employee’s email and the invoice number from a scanned invoice. If you run into any issues when following this tutorial, you can contact us by clicking the Report an issue button below. OpenCV is an open source computer vision library originally developed by Intel. I hope it will be useful for you who want to try Vision API without being bothered to get the token API from Google Cloud. 今回は、Google Cloud Vision APIのOCRを試してみたら精度が良すぎてビビったので、やり方と結果を紹介してみます。 1,Google Cloud Vision APIを使うためのkeyの取得. One of my colleague suggested to use "Tesseract API". The Vision X’s vast array of processing capabilities can be further enriched with the modular addition of the Panini ScanStation and/or thermal printer, while preserving the scanner’s footprint and ensuring optimized ergonomics and integrated cable management. Cloud Vision API: Integrates Google Vision features, including image labeling, face, logo, and landmark detection, optical character recognition (OCR), and detection of explicit content, into applications.


I take a very practical approach, using more than 50 Code Examples. Resources include A-Level Biology Revision Notes, A-Level Biology Help Forums (General Revision + Edexcel, AQA, OCR & WJEC), Exam Specs, Exam Papers, Biology Revision Guides (A. The examples are extracted from open source Java projects. To see this sample app in action, build and run the project, then use the buttons in the sample app’s toolbar to take a picture or choose an image from your photo library. Les activités UiPath sont des blocs élémentaires de projets d'automation. In the Code Samples section you can find the Visual C# sample, which will help you to start development with Cloud OCR SDK. In this post we will focus on explaining how to use OCR on Android. OCR WEB SERVICE SOAP and REST Cloud API. The Vision API can detect and transcribe text from PDF and TIFF files stored in Google Cloud Storage. 58893/ 47307 47308 Click on Detect Text to start the OCR (you can set the flash. Safe Search Detection to detect inappropriate content within your image. Before going through this tutorial, you must have the Java SE Development Kit (JDK) on your local development environment. scan(image); Read the result. …So here we are. Example of using OCR and Image Automation Suggest Edits Since OCR and Image automation usually go hand in hand due to the difficulty of automating in virtual environments, we created an automation that retrieves an employee’s email and the invoice number from a scanned invoice. This will take you to a. Google Cloud Vision. Google’s corporate vision is “to provide access to the world’s information in one click. Go to the Google Cloud Platform website and click the try for free button. In this article, we are going to learn how to use Google Vision API with ASP. This page provides Java source code for MainActivity. Cloud Vision API: Integrates Google Vision features, including image labeling, face, logo, and landmark detection, optical character recognition (OCR), and detection of explicit content, into applications. Lets take an example to understand this: In the following program, we have a data member num declared in the child class, the member with the same name is already present in the parent class. Google has been working on OCR technology from the days of Google Docs and they have carried over the feature to Google Keep.


Prerequisites. Google's corporate vision is "to provide access to the world's information in one click. What Is Google's Vision Statement? Google's official mission or vision statement is to organize all of the data in the world and make it accessible for everyone in a useful way. The default classifier is based in the scene text recognition method proposed by Lukás Neumann & Jiri Matas in [Neumann11b]. Then recently in June 2016 these issues were resolved and Mobile Vision APIs were re-launched. In this video we have used the google vision Api using OCR concepts in Android Studio. Three birds with one stone B4A Tutorial MJPEG / CCTV Server B4A Question (of OCR only. Assume i bought and have the valid Google Vision API credentials and would like to know does any standalone open source or commercial client is available which is already integrated with Google Vision API which has other features as well. Between 1995 and 2006 it had little work done on it, but since then it has been improved extensively by Google. Example: A dog has states-color, name, breed as well as. This Opencv C++ tutorial is about extracting text from an image using Tesseract OCR libraries. flutter_mobile_vision_example # Demonstrates how to use the flutter_mobile_vision plugin.


"Mobile Vision" is an interesting framework by Google. B4A Library OCR, FaceRecognition, BarcodeScanner using Google Vision. Consider five different examples of how your business can begin using optical character recognition to create efficiencies and cut overhead expenses: 1. The next part of the code will be properly commented so the read out should be easier. Example of Neural Network OCR Font Learning using Bitmaps. 58893/ 47307 47308 Click on Detect Text to start the OCR (you can set the flash. ocr-library ocr-recognition optical-character-recognition text-characters textrecognition vision-api google-vision-api. LEADTOOLS provides fast and highly accurate Optical Character Recognition SDK technology for. 2018 : Dynamsoft Document Capture Cloud Java Sample Code: The Dynamsoft Document Capture Cloud Java Sample Code demonstrates how to convert image to text by using DDC Ocr. Optical character recognition (OCR) refers to the process of automatically identifying from an image characters or symbols belonging to a specified alphabet. OCR Test Images The images below are intended to be a severe test of optical character recognition (OCR) software. Find A-Level Biology Revision Resources + Edexcel, AQA & OCR specific Biology Revision Resources for A-Level Students. android-vision / visionSamples / ocr-reader / app / src / main / java / com / google / android / gms / samples / vision / ocrreader / theoreticalb Getting rid of vestigial Update method; already removed from the other …. It is a javascript version of the Tesseract Open Source OCR Engine. Now learn JavaScript on your own at your home and that too without internet. The example assumes that the server is running on localhost, on the default port, and it uses redis dbs 0 and 1 for its data. But when it comes to scanning a realtime camera feed.


theraysmith@gmail. In your project-level build. I don't think it does (as of May 2017, it may change in the future). Three birds with one stone B4A Tutorial MJPEG / CCTV Server B4A Question (of OCR only. Introduction In our previous article we learned how to Analyze an Image Using Computer Vision API With ASP. The input pattern values are presented and assigned to the input nodes of the input layer. - [Instructor] So to understand more about…an example of a machine learning service…that Google Cloud is offering,…we're going to look at the Cloud Vision API. Examples for Vision 1D. Once detected, the recognizer then determines the actual text in each block and segments it into lines and words. I want to use text-detection from image (OCR) of google cloud vision api. With ML Kit's text recognition APIs, you can recognize text in any Latin-based language (and more, with Cloud-based text recognition). What Is Google's Vision Statement? Google's official mission or vision statement is to organize all of the data in the world and make it accessible for everyone in a useful way. Download the project as a. Another use case is to archive images and indexing them with data extracted from the content. ABBYY's Cloud OCR SDK is a Web OCR service providing the excellent quality of ABBYY’s text recognition via an application programming interface (API). By uploading an image or specifying an image URL, Microsoft Computer Vision algorithms can analyze visual content in different ways based on inputs and user choices. So far, the best OCR to choose on production code can be found with Google Vision API (which scans and results the image attributes as REST JSON). OCR WEB SERVICE SOAP and REST Cloud API. Text Recognition API Overview.


Microsoft cognitive-services VS Google Vision API Simple comparison of result of Microsoft cognitive-services VS Google Vision API. getBoundingBox. OpenCV is an open source computer vision library originally developed by Intel. The OCR tutorial is hosted in the Google Cloud Functions documentation. Google Docs API tests a new feature that lets you perform OCR (optical character recognition) on an image. Object - Objects have states and behaviors. To change the OCR language, right-click the Capture2Text tray icon, select the OCR Language option and then select the desired language. " The company's nature of business is a direct manifestation of this vision statement. Resources include A-Level Biology Revision Notes, A-Level Biology Help Forums (General Revision + Edexcel, AQA, OCR & WJEC), Exam Specs, Exam Papers, Biology Revision Guides (A. It it throws an exception for not having the outpath, particularly this code does not work (I have tried different types of outpath). But when it comes to scanning a realtime camera feed. With the advent of libraries such as Tesseract and Ocrad, more and more developers are building libraries and bots that use OCR in novel, interesting ways. I intend to post benchmarks of OCR software here but have not run any tests yet. It is a SUPER OCR (Optical Character Recognition) app-design-components. The Cloud OCR API is a REST-based Web API to extract text from images and convert scans to searchable PDF. The Optical Character Recognition (OCR) is the recognition of printed or written text characters by Mobile Camera.


Google Vision Ocr Example Java